最新接入DeepSeek-V3模型,点击下载最新版本InsCode AI IDE
前端面试中的制胜法宝:智能化工具助力高效开发
在前端开发领域,技术的更新换代日新月异。面对复杂的项目需求和激烈的职场竞争,掌握高效的开发工具成为了每个开发者脱颖而出的关键。本文将探讨如何利用智能化工具提升前端开发效率,并分享一些实用技巧,帮助你在前端面试中大放异彩。
一、智能化工具的崛起
随着人工智能技术的不断进步,越来越多的智能工具被引入到软件开发领域。这些工具不仅能够显著提高开发效率,还能帮助开发者更专注于创意和技术难点的解决。其中,AI编程助手以其强大的代码生成、自动补全和错误修复功能,成为许多开发者的得力助手。
二、前端开发的新时代
前端开发曾经是一个需要大量手工编码的工作,开发者需要对HTML、CSS和JavaScript等语言有深入的理解。然而,随着智能化工具的出现,这一情况正在发生改变。通过自然语言描述,开发者可以快速生成所需的代码片段,减少了重复劳动,提高了工作效率。
三、实战应用:从零开始构建一个响应式网页
假设你正在准备一场前端面试,面试官要求你现场编写一个响应式网页。传统的做法是打开编辑器,手动编写HTML、CSS和JavaScript代码。但如果你使用了智能化工具,整个过程将变得轻松得多。
-
项目初始化
使用智能化工具,你可以通过简单的对话框输入需求,如“创建一个包含导航栏、轮播图和产品展示区的响应式网页”。工具会自动生成基本的HTML结构,并为你提供多种模板选择。 -
样式设计
接下来,你可以通过自然语言描述所需的样式,如“导航栏背景为蓝色,字体颜色为白色,字体大小为18px”。智能化工具会根据你的描述自动生成对应的CSS代码,甚至可以根据屏幕尺寸自动调整样式,确保网页在不同设备上的显示效果一致。 -
交互逻辑
对于JavaScript部分,你可以描述所需的功能,如“点击导航栏按钮时,页面滚动到相应部分”。工具会自动生成相应的JavaScript代码,并提供详细的注释,帮助你理解每一行代码的作用。 -
调试与优化
智能化工具还具备强大的调试功能,可以在运行时检测并修复代码中的错误。此外,它还能分析代码性能,给出优化建议,确保网页加载速度和用户体验达到最佳状态。
四、智能化工具的优势
-
降低学习曲线
对于初学者来说,智能化工具提供了友好的用户界面和直观的操作方式,使得学习编程变得更加容易。即使没有深厚的编程基础,也能快速上手,完成复杂的开发任务。 -
提高开发效率
智能化工具能够自动生成大量代码,减少重复劳动,使开发者能够专注于创意和技术难点的解决。这不仅提高了开发效率,还能缩短项目的交付周期。 -
提升代码质量
智能化工具内置了代码检查和优化功能,能够自动检测并修复代码中的错误,提供高质量的代码生成。此外,它还能根据最新的编程规范和最佳实践,给出合理的建议,确保代码的可读性和维护性。 -
增强团队协作
在团队开发中,智能化工具可以帮助成员之间更好地沟通和协作。通过共享代码库和协作平台,团队成员可以实时查看和修改代码,提高项目的整体质量和一致性。
五、推荐工具:智能化IDE
在众多智能化工具中,有一款特别值得一提的工具——它不仅具备强大的AI编程能力,还能为开发者提供高效、便捷的编程体验。这款工具集成了VSCode Monaco Editor和GitCode插件框架,支持多种编程语言和框架,适用于各种开发场景。无论是初学者还是经验丰富的开发者,都能从中受益匪浅。
六、结语
在前端开发领域,智能化工具已经成为提升效率和质量的重要手段。通过合理利用这些工具,你可以在面试中展现出卓越的技术实力和解决问题的能力。不仅如此,它们还能帮助你在日常工作中更加高效地完成任务,提升职业竞争力。
如果你希望在前端开发中取得更大的突破,不妨尝试一下这款智能化IDE。它不仅能简化编程过程,还能帮助你更快地实现创意和技术目标。立即下载并体验吧!
附录:智能化工具的核心特性
- 全局代码生成/改写:理解整个项目,生成或修改多个文件。
- 代码补全:在编写代码时提供补全建议,支持单行和多行代码。
- 智能问答:通过自然对话互动,应对编程挑战。
- 解释代码:快速理解代码逻辑,提高开发效率。
- 添加注释:快速为代码添加注释,提升可读性。
- 生成单元测试:为代码生成测试用例,验证准确性。
- 修复错误:分析代码,提供修改建议。
- 优化代码:分析性能瓶颈,执行优化方案。
通过这些特性,智能化工具不仅提升了开发效率,还极大地改善了开发体验。快来下载并试用吧!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考